Sighting in Mallala in 1954

Summary

In January 1954, a witness in Mallala, South Australia, reported a silver object with a yellow trail flying in a straight path northward. The object appeared suddenly, vanished mid-air, and was only seen for a brief moment. A sound like an aircraft with its engines off was heard, suggesting it was accompanied. Despite the short observation, the report concluded it was likely a bright meteor.

The testimony was recorded by the Royal Australian Air Force, which classified it as a possible astronomical phenomenon. No photos or radar were involved, and the report lacked conclusive evidence of an unidentified object. Although the description was clear, the lack of additional data limited the evaluation. The case remained in archives for decades before being officially declassified.
